In the final stage of water treatment, whether for high-tech manufacturing, pharmaceutical production, or high-end food and beverage processing, the focus shifts from treatment to preservation. Purified water tanks are the specialized vessels designed to hold water that has already undergone extensive filtration, deionization, or reverse osmosis. This water is exceptionally clean, but its purity makes it chemically "unstable." Because it lacks minerals, purified water is naturally aggressive, seeking to absorb ions from its environment. Any contact with unprotected metal or porous concrete leads to immediate contamination, as the water pulls iron or minerals from the tank walls. For facilities requiring ultra-pure water, the storage tank must be an absolute barrier that prevents any degradation of the water’s quality before it reaches the production line.

Traditional welded tanks often fail to maintain these standards because the heat from on-site welding destroys the integrity of the coating at the seams, creating sites for rust and bacterial growth. Engineering for Purity and Chemical Stability

A purified water tank must be a sterile, non-reactive environment that prioritizes the stability of the water's molecular profile:

 

Inert, Non-Leaching Barrier: Purified water must remain free of metallic ions. The Fusion Bonded Epoxy barrier ensures that no iron, manganese, or chemical residues migrate into the supply, keeping the water corrosion-free and maintaining the precise conductivity required for the process.

 

 

Inhibition of Biofilms and Bacterial Colonies: Even in purified systems, microscopic organic matter can trigger biofilm growth. The ultra-smooth, non-porous finish of the epoxy coating prevents bacteria from anchoring to the walls, ensuring the tank remains biologically clean and easier to sanitize.

 

 

Resistance to Sanitization Reagents: Purified water systems are frequently sanitized using ozone, heat, or mild chemical agents. Our factory-cured epoxy is specifically engineered to resist these processes, ensuring the lining does not blister or delaminate over time.

 

 

Structural Safety for Critical Feed Systems: High-tech manufacturing relies on a constant feed of pure water. The high-tensile strength of the steel panels provides the structural safety factors necessary to ensure the supply is never interrupted by structural failure or leaks.

 

 

Technical Excellence: The Fusion Bonded Epoxy Barrier

The reliability of a purified water reservoir is rooted in the Fusion Bonded Epoxy (FBE) manufacturing process. Conducted entirely in a controlled factory environment, this process ensures a level of coating uniformity and bond strength that field-applied paint cannot match.

The process begins with the precision preparation of high-strength steel panels. Each panel is grit-blasted to achieve a near-white finish, creating an ideal mechanical anchor profile. A specialized, high-grade thermosetting epoxy powder—often certified for food-grade and potable safety—is then electrostatically applied. The panels are cured in industrial ovens at extreme temperatures, causing the epoxy to melt, flow, and undergo a chemical cross-linking reaction, molecularly fusing it to the steel substrate.

This results in a dense, uniform, and incredibly tough barrier. Because the panels are coated before assembly, every edge and pre-punched bolt hole is fully encapsulated. On-site, these panels are joined using specialized high-strength fasteners and food-grade sealants, creating a structure that is immune to the atmospheric and chemical stresses of high-purity service.

 

Protecting Quality with Aluminum Dome Roofs

In the management of purified water, the roof is the primary defense against airborne particulates and light-driven biological growth. This is why the integration of Aluminum Dome Roofs has become a strategic standard:

 

Total Light Exclusion to Prevent Algae: Sunlight penetration can trigger algae blooms even in highly treated water. Aluminum Dome Roofs provide a total light barrier, keeping the water clear and biologically stable.

 

 

Maintenance-Free Hygiene in Industrial Air: Purified water tanks are often located in industrial zones with high humidity. While a steel roof would require constant repainting to prevent rust flakes from falling into the water, aluminum is naturally resistant to corrosion.

 

 

Prevention of Bird and Dust Contamination: The dome provides a secure, bird-proof seal that prevents avian waste and wind-blown dust from entering the reservoir, which is critical for maintaining the high standards of purified systems.

 

 

Lightweight Geodesic Design: The geodesic design provides immense structural strength without internal support columns. This eliminates internal roosting spots for pests and simplifies the periodic sterilization of the tank interior.

 

 

Rapid Deployment and Modular Scalability

For a pharmaceutical plant or a semiconductor facility, the speed of installation is a major advantage. Because the components are prefabricated, the on-site assembly of an Epoxy Bonded Steel Bolted Tank is fast and efficient, requiring no on-site welding. This allows facilities to bring new high-purity storage online quickly with minimal disruption to the production floor.

Furthermore, the modular nature of the system allows for future flexibility. If a facility increases its production capacity and needs more purified water storage, these tanks can often be heightened by adding more rings of panels. This modularity ensures that the initial infrastructure investment remains a long-term asset that can evolve with the facility's technical needs.
